Over 73,000 'gotaways' at southern border in November, highest ever recorded:
Border crisis under Biden admin keeps breaking records
More than 73,000 illegal immigrants evaded Border Patrol agents in November, according to new data seen by Fox News, marking the highest number ever recorded at the southern border.
The number of "gotaways" refers to the number of illegal immigrants who have evaded overwhelmed Border Patrol agents and have been detected by other forms of surveillance but not caught. It does not count those who were not spotted. 
The number of gotaways for November means that there are already over 137,000 gotaways so far this fiscal year, which began in October. In FY2022 there were nearly 600,000 gotaways. There were 389,155 gotaways at the border in FY2021.
The November numbers means that there have been an average of at least 2,400 people evading Border Patrol every day.
The data also indicates that there have been at least 207,000 migrant encounters in November, which would be significantly higher than the 174,000 encountered in November last year, and the 72,113 encountered in November 2020.
There were more than 2.3 million migrant encounters in FY2022 and more than 1.7 million in FY2021. So far, FY2023 is on track to exceed both of those numbers. --->READ MORE HERE

72K Migrant Got-Aways in December, 212K in Last Three Months:
U.S. Border Patrol officials estimate that 72,000 migrants got away without being apprehended after they illegally crossed the U.S.-Mexico Border, according to a source operating under the umbrella of U.S. Customs and Border Protection. This adds to the 140,000 estimated got-aways during the first two months of the new fiscal year bringing the total to approximately 212,000.
The source told Breitbart Texas that approximately 72,000 migrants are classified as got-aways during the month of December. The El Paso Sector alone accounted for approximately 32,000 of these got-aways. Agents in the El Paso Sector apprehended nearly 56,000 migrants in December. This brings the total of known border crossings to 88,000 for the month.
Gotaways are an estimate by Border Patrol officials of migrants that are either seen and not apprehended or are counted by other means including technology and tracking. These are migrants who illegally cross the border with no intention of surrendering to law enforcement to claim asylum, officials previously told Breitbart. --->READ MORE HERE
